The City of Garland is seeking bids for the Monica Park Wastewater Replacements project, a major public works initiative in Garland, Texas. - Government Buyer: - City of Garland, Procurement & Contract Administration division - Project Scope: - Replacement of approximately 9,450 linear feet of 8-inch wastewater mains by open cut - Installation of 44 standard 4-foot diameter precast wastewater manholes with Raven 405 Lining or approved equal - Installation of 239 four-inch wastewater service laterals and cleanouts - Replacement of about 10,950 square yards of alleys, streets, driveways, and sidewalks - Restoration with 10,150 square yards of sodding, including fertilizer and sprinkling - Additional work includes tree protection/trimming, concrete/asphalt removal, erosion control, traffic control, and mobilization - Products & Materials: - 8-inch PVC SDR-26 wastewater pipe (ASTM D3034): 9,125 LF - 8-inch PVC SDR-26 wastewater pipe (ASTM D2241): 249 LF - 4-inch wastewater services: 239 units - Raven 405 Lining or approved equal for manhole rehabilitation - Concrete and asphalt paving materials, sodding, trench safety equipment - OEMs & Vendors: - No specific OEMs or vendors are named; Raven 405 Lining is referenced as a proprietary product - Unique Requirements: - Compliance with prevailing wage rates - Mandatory electronic bid submission via Ion Wave portal - 5% bid bond required; performance, payment, and maintenance bonds required for award - Mandatory pre-bid meeting via Microsoft Teams - Detailed plans, specifications, and forms included in bid package - Estimated Contract Value: - Approximately $7.4 million - Period of Performance: - 400 working days for completion, with a two-year maintenance bond after acceptance

The City of Garland is soliciting bids for construction services involving wastewater replacements in the Monica Park neighborhood. The project includes approximately 9,450 linear feet of 8-inch wastewater main replacement by open cut, manholes, service laterals, sodding, and replacement of alleys, streets, driveways, and sidewalks. Bidders must submit sealed bids electronically through the City's procurement portal by July 23, 2026. A 5% bid bond is required with the bid submission, and performance, payment, and maintenance bonds will be required upon award. A pre-bid meeting will be held via Microsoft Teams on July 15, 2026.
